The call for speaker presentation ideas is now open for the Ethanol Producer Magazineannounced this week the preliminary agenda for the 2023 International Fuel Ethanol Workshop & Expo (FEW) taking place June 12-14, 2023 at the CHI Health Center in Omaha, Nebraska. This year’s agenda includes two co-located events: Biodiesel Summit: Sustainable Aviation Fuel & Renewable Biodiesel and Carbon Capture & Storage Summit, along with the annual pre-conference event, Ethanol 101. “In addition to ethanol production and product diversification for ethanol producers, this year’s agenda is covering multiple topics about carbon capture and storage, biodiesel and renewable diesel production, as well as sustainable aviation fuel production,” says John Nelson, vice president of operations, sales and marketing at BBI International. “And as we have in the past, the agenda will allow those new to the industry to learn some of the basics in Ethanol 101, taking place Monday June 12th.” The program includes nearly 150 presentations across multiple consecutive tracks, including: Track 1: Production and Operations – Biological Processes Track 2: Production and Operations – Mechanical Processes and Plant Control Track 3: Coproducts and Product Diversification Track 4: Leadership and Financial Management Biodiesel & Renewable Diesel Summit Carbon Capture & Storage Summit To view the online agenda for the FEW and all other co-located events, click here.
